🎯 Lamar Jackson UNDER 19.5 Pass Completions

Best Price: -125 on ESPN Bet

Recent Performance

  • Last Game: 19 Completions

  • Season Average: 16.5 Completions/G

Key Analysis

Jackson needed 29 pass attempts last week just to hit 19 completions, and he’s averaging a 69% completion rate so far this season. To clear 19.5, he’d likely need another ~29 attempts. That’s tough to bank on considering his career average is only 25 attempts per game. Baltimore’s offense still leans on the run, keeping his volume capped more often than not.

Risk Factors

  • Run game gets shut down again and Lamar has to use his arm to stay in the game

🎯 DeAndre Hopkins OVER 19.5 Receiving Yards

Best Price: -107 BetRivers

Recent Performance

  • Last Game: 64 Yards

  • Season Average: 49.5 Yds/G

Key Analysis

Hopkins has been ultra-efficient to start the season, 4 catches on 4 targets for an average of 24.75 yards per reception. That means he technically only needs one catch to cash this line. With a season average nearly 2.5x higher than tonight’s number, this prop feels like a clear case of the books not fully adjusting to his role and usage.

Risk Factors

  • Lions allowing the 12th lowest passing yards in the NFL

🎯 Jared Goff OVER 1.5 Passing Touchdowns

Best Price: -114 on FanDuel

Recent Performance

  • Last Game: 5 TDs

  • Season Average: 3 TD/G

Key Analysis

Goff is distributing the ball well, with 6 passing touchdowns already spread across 4 different receivers this season. The Ravens have been vulnerable through the air, giving up 2 passing TDs per game. With Detroit’s offense clicking and multiple red-zone threats, Goff has multiple avenues to clear this number.

Risk Factors

  • Run game is working and limited possessions to get 2+ passing TD
